Common Causes of Construction Delays and How to Prevent Them
Introduction
Construction projects are complex undertakings involving multiple stakeholders, contractors, consultants, suppliers, regulatory authorities, and project teams. Even the most carefully planned projects can experience delays that affect completion dates, increase costs, and reduce profitability. Construction delays remain one of the most common challenges faced by contractors and project owners worldwide. Delays can lead to contractual disputes, extension of time claims, liquidated damages, loss of productivity, and strained client relationships. Understanding the common causes of construction delays is the first step toward implementing effective project controls and minimizing schedule risks. This article explores the major causes of construction delays and provides practical strategies for preventing them.
What Is a Construction Delay?
A construction delay occurs when project activities take longer than planned, resulting in a failure to achieve scheduled milestones or project completion dates. Delays can affect:
- Individual activities
- Project phases
- Critical path activities
- Overall project completion
The impact of delays often extends beyond schedule performance and may affect:
- Project costs
- Resource utilization
- Cash flow
- Contractual obligations
- Client satisfaction

1. Poor Project Planning
One of the leading causes of construction delays is inadequate planning during project initiation. Common planning deficiencies include:
- Unrealistic project durations
- Missing activities
- Incorrect activity sequencing
- Incomplete resource planning
- Lack of risk assessment
Without a realistic baseline schedule, projects often encounter difficulties during execution.
Prevention Strategies
- Develop detailed project schedules
- Conduct constructability reviews
- Use Primavera P6 or MS Project
- Involve key stakeholders during planning
- Establish realistic durations
Proper planning forms the foundation of successful project delivery.
2. Design Changes and Scope Creep
Construction projects frequently experience changes after work has commenced. Examples include:
- Revised drawings
- Additional work requirements
- Client-requested modifications
- Design development changes
Scope changes often disrupt planned work sequences and impact critical path activities.
Prevention Strategies
- Complete design development before construction
- Establish formal change management procedures
- Review design documents thoroughly
- Monitor variation requests closely
Effective change control minimizes disruption and schedule impacts.
3. Delayed Approvals and Decision-Making
Projects often depend on timely decisions and approvals from clients, consultants, and regulatory authorities. Delays may occur due to:
- Slow drawing approvals
- Delayed material approvals
- Late responses to RFIs
- Delayed permit issuance
When critical approvals are delayed, project progress can quickly slow down.
Prevention Strategies
- Maintain approval tracking logs
- Establish response deadlines
- Conduct regular coordination meetings
- Escalate critical issues promptly
Efficient communication improves project responsiveness.
4. Material Procurement Delays
Materials are essential for maintaining project momentum. Common procurement-related issues include:
- Late supplier deliveries
- Material shortages
- Import restrictions
- Transportation disruptions
- Supply chain issues
Material delays often affect critical construction activities.
Prevention Strategies
- Develop procurement schedules
- Identify long-lead items early
- Maintain supplier communication
- Monitor procurement progress regularly
Effective procurement planning reduces schedule risk.
5. Labor Shortages and Productivity Issues
Labor availability significantly affects project performance. Common workforce challenges include:
- Skilled labor shortages
- High workforce turnover
- Poor supervision
- Low productivity
- Industrial disputes
Labor-related issues often result in extended activity durations.
Prevention Strategies
- Conduct workforce planning
- Monitor productivity trends
- Provide adequate supervision
- Implement workforce retention strategies
A stable and productive workforce supports project success.
6. Adverse Weather Conditions
Weather can have a significant impact on construction activities. Examples include:
- Heavy rainfall
- Extreme temperatures
- Strong winds
- Flooding
- Storm events
Weather-related delays are particularly common on infrastructure and external works projects.
Prevention Strategies
- Consider seasonal conditions during planning
- Develop weather contingency plans
- Monitor forecasts regularly
- Adjust work sequences where possible
Proactive planning can reduce weather-related disruptions.
7. Poor Site Management
Ineffective site management often contributes to project delays. Common issues include:
- Inadequate supervision
- Poor coordination
- Safety incidents
- Resource conflicts
- Inefficient work sequencing
Even well-planned projects can suffer when site execution is poorly managed.
Prevention Strategies
- Establish clear site procedures
- Conduct regular progress reviews
- Improve communication channels
- Monitor performance indicators
Strong site leadership improves project execution.
8. Equipment Breakdowns and Resource Constraints
Construction activities depend heavily on equipment availability. Problems may include:
- Equipment failures
- Maintenance issues
- Insufficient equipment capacity
- Delayed mobilization
Resource shortages can significantly impact productivity.
Prevention Strategies
- Implement preventive maintenance programs
- Monitor equipment utilization
- Maintain backup equipment where possible
- Plan resource requirements carefully
Reliable resources support continuous project progress.
9. Contractual and Commercial Issues
Commercial disputes can create major project disruptions. Examples include:
- Payment delays
- Contract interpretation disputes
- Variation disagreements
- Claims and counterclaims
Unresolved commercial issues often affect project performance and stakeholder relationships.
Prevention Strategies
- Maintain strong contract administration
- Keep accurate project records
- Address disputes early
- Conduct regular contract reviews
Effective contract management supports project continuity.
10. Inadequate Communication and Coordination
Construction projects involve multiple stakeholders working simultaneously. Communication failures may result in:
- Conflicting instructions
- Rework
- Delayed decisions
- Coordination problems
Poor communication frequently contributes to avoidable delays.
Prevention Strategies
- Hold regular coordination meetings
- Maintain communication protocols
- Use project collaboration platforms
- Issue timely reports and updates
Strong communication improves project alignment.
The Role of Project Controls in Preventing Delays
Project Controls play a critical role in identifying and mitigating schedule risks. Key project controls activities include:
- Schedule Development
- Progress Monitoring
- Critical Path Analysis
- Resource Planning
- Risk Management
- Performance Reporting
Project controls provide early warning indicators that help management address issues before they become major delays.

Common Warning Signs of Potential Delays
Project teams should monitor indicators such as:
- Missed milestones
- Falling productivity rates
- Procurement delays
- Resource shortages
- Increasing variation orders
- Unresolved RFIs
- Slow approval processes
Early detection allows management to take corrective action before delays escalate.
